Artists for the evening are Carisa and Kody Feiner. Doors will open at 6:30, with performances starting at 7pm.

Carisa's music is best categorized as bedroom cafe. It hints at some of her influences, primarily bossa nova, folk, and jazz. Her lyrics are often straight from the pages of her journal and are always autobiographical in some way. She primarily performs music with her guitar and has been playing gigs steadily in the Madison area since moving here in 2020.

Kody Feiner is the lead singer of local bluegrass/americana band Soggy Prairie, a band that he helped found in 2002 while still a student at Sun Prairie High School. He has an extensive knowledge of mountain music from many eras, and his songs showcase a modern take on traditional music.
